Registering your trip with the Saudi Arabia embassy is a crucial step for any traveler. It enhances safety, ensuring that the embassy can effectively communicate important information during emergencies. In scenarios such as natural disasters, such as earthquakes or floods, embassy registration allows authorities to quickly account for citizens and provide necessary assistance. In cases of political unrest, being registered enables the embassy to send timely alerts and guidance, helping travelers navigate volatile situations. Furthermore, if a medical emergency arises, the embassy can offer essential support, including locating medical facilities and providing information on local healthcare providers. Proactive registration empowers travelers with a safety net, reinforcing their security and wellbeing while abroad.
Can the Saudi Arabia embassy assist in legal issues abroad?
Yes, the Saudi Arabia embassy can provide guidance and support related to legal issues, including connecting you with local legal services and advising on your rights under local laws.
What should I do if I lose my Saudi Arabia passport in Djibouti?
If you lose your passport, report the loss to the local police and contact the Saudi Arabia embassy immediately for assistance in obtaining a replacement passport.
Can the embassy help with medical emergencies?
Yes, the embassy can assist in medical emergencies by providing information about local hospitals, helping coordinate transportation, and communicating with family back home as needed.
What services does the embassy provide regarding travel alerts?
The embassy issues travel alerts and safety updates for citizens traveling in Djibouti, keeping you informed about any unfolding risks or security concerns.
Is there support for Saudi nationals detained abroad?
Yes, the embassy plays a crucial role in supporting nationals who find themselves detained, assisting with legal representation and providing necessary resources.
The Saudi Arabia diplomatic presence in Djibouti is highlighted by the Saudi Arabian embassy located in Djibouti City. The embassy’s primary functions include fostering international relations, providing consular services to Saudi citizens, and supporting bilateral cooperation in trade and security matters. The embassy plays a pivotal role in both economic and cultural exchanges between the two nations, promoting mutual interests and solidarity. Overall, the Saudi diplomatic mission in Djibouti enhances the bilateral relationship, contributing to stability in the Horn of Africa while ensuring the welfare of Saudi nationals abroad.
